Budget Friendly Tax
Payment Plan
For those whose property taxes aren’t escrowed, we offer
a budget friendly Installment Payment Plan (IPP) for real
estate property tax and tangible personal property tax. The
IPP divides your taxes into four installments due in June/July,
September, December, and March, and includes a discount
of just under 4 percent.
First Time Applicants: The deadline to sign up for 2022
is April 30. You are officially enrolled in the plan when the
